Total Engineering, Inc. operates as a civil construction contractor focused on earthwork, roadway and bridge projects, along with demolition of buildings and sites. It also designs and constructs utility infrastructure, including storm drainage, sanitary sewer, water distribution, and electrical/telecommunication distribution networks. Established in 1999 and headquartered in Lanham, Maryland, the company maintains district offices in Norfolk, Virginia, and Columbus, Georgia. It serves owners, municipalities, and general contractors across transportation, rail, airports, commercial, residential, institutional, industrial, and parks projects, typically handling work valued from half a million to sixty million dollars. The firm operates within the civil construction sector and presents itself as a regional contractor capable of managing a range of infrastructure and site development tasks.
